If measuring voltage from the control board to the hall sensor, follow the
following steps:
1. Unplug the power cord.
2. Remove the rear washer panel.
3. Locate the Hall sensor connector on the stator behind the rotor.
4. Place the meter leads on terminals 5 to 4, white to gray.
5. Plug in the power cord, close the door, and press the power button.
DO NOT PRESS START!
6. You should measure 10 to 15 V

Hall Sensor Testing
The hall sensor can be tested from the
control board or at the hall sensor.
Ohm Testing the Hall Sensor
If tested off the stator using the
diagram on the previous page, ohm
check the resistors from pin 5 to pin 1
and pin 2. If the hall sensor is good,
you should measure approximately 10
KΩ from pin 5 to pin 1 and 10 KΩ from
pin 5 to pin 2. If either test shows an
open (infinity) the hall sensor is
defective and must be replaced.
